Tony's Pizzeria's staff can accommodate 65 customers per hour. Tony suspects that his mean customer load diffors from 65. He performod a hypothesis test with 0 UE and came up with a Vatue of 0.18. State the 2 h otheses ret u and and state the conclusion Ho: u 65 a: If in fact the mean number of customers is 65 per hour, then there is Ha: LL 65 a 5% chance that Tony will conclude that the mean number of customers per hour is not 65. P-Value: If the mean number of customers per hour is 65 and if we sample the same number of hours repeatedly, then 18% of the samples will result in a sample mean farther from 65 than the sample mean that the Tony obtained.

Explanation / Answer

In testing of hypothesis, if the p-value is greater than the level of significance, the null hypothesis H0 is accepted which is the same as saying that the alternative Ha is rejected.

With reference to the given question, we are given level of significance, = 0.05 and p-value = 0.18 which is greater than 0.05. So, the null hypothesis H0, µ = 65 is accepted which is the same as saying that the alternative Ha,   µ 65 is rejected. Hence, we conclude that Tony's suspecion is NOT statistically valid.DONE
